Product Description

The 8753D vector network analyzer provides not only magnitude and phase information, but also offers up to 110 dB dynamic range, makes group delay and time domain measurements, and utilizes vector accuracy enhancement to minimize measurement uncertainty.

  • Built-in S-parameter test set for complete forward and reverse measurements, allowing you to completely characterize your component with a single connection
  • Superb accuracy, with the most comprehensive calibration available
  • Optional time domain and swept harmonic measurements
  • Mixer testing with frequency offset capability
  • Optional step attenuator for extended source output power range
  • Pass/fail testing, interpolative error correction, test sequencing, and user-defined test frequencies to enhance productivity  
  • Frequency range from 30 kHz to 3 GHz, or optionally 6 GHz.
  • 50 and 75 ohm solutions
